@DonkeyInvestor We adults only have tax-free allowances of up to 1000 euros per year. Children can collect up to approx. 10000 Euro tax-free. Attention from a limit of about 7000 euros, they would have to take out an independent health insurance - the limits are adjusted annually. You have to be aware that it is a gift to the children and that you cannot simply transfer it to yourself later - otherwise the tax office will probably contact you. I have therefore donated quite a large sum to my son and only use distributing ETFs. My annual goal is to max out his 7 K in allowances and of course the 1 K each from me and my wife. So 9 K of realized gains per year. I love to save tax and I have no problem with the gift to my son.

I have made a note to myself that I will check this again more closely at 6820 euros- since having your own health insurance would of course negate all the positive effects again. We have applied for a non-assessment certificate for the little one and deposited it with all banks. Profits are then transferred immediately without deductions.
